Government real estate organisation launches second phase of inventiveness programme

Dubai - United Arab Emirates, 21 June 2015: Dubai Land Department (DLD) has announced the successful conclusion of the first phase of its Corporate Innovation and Creativity Diploma and the subsequent launch of its second phase. The Diploma, which was introduced in May 2015, is a product of DLD's Corporate Planning & Development Department, its Creativity & Innovation Department and Dubai Real Estate Institute, DLD's educational arm.

"The Corporate Innovation and Creativity Diploma complements the vision of the wise leadership of the UAE to encourage forward thinking and inventiveness in the workplace. It was launched in line with Highness Sheikh Mohammed bin Rashid Al Maktoum, UAE Vice President Prime Minister and Ruler of Dubai's announcement that 2015 was to be the year of innovation in the country. The programme has been formulated to be compatible with DLD's strategy and goals, which involves the consolidation of a policy of excellence in our operations and in our services to customers," said HE Majida Ali Rashid, Assistant Director General of DLD.

DLD has made its Corporate Innovation and Creativity Diploma available to all its employees and has also opened it up for colleagues from other Dubai Government Departments. Its syllabus is based on training and rehabilitation to recognise the importance of creativity and innovation in the development of institutional work.

The first phase of the Diploma focused on highlighting the potential of the human mind and the individual and institutional factors that play a role in achieving creativity within an organisation. It included 36 hours of training on the tools and methods needed for creative thinking around six different themes; the brain in creative thinking, creative thinking, creativity and innovation in the public sector, the art of brainstorming, the art creative of leadership and positive energy.

The second phase of the Diploma takes the form of a 'Creative Laboratory,' which DLD says is intended to define the orientations of future government operations and highlight how associate government members can actively participate in the way forward. It aims to reveal practical applications by producing innovative ideas for the real estate environment.
